The Hydration Powerhouse: Multi-Weight Hyaluronic Acid

Hyaluronic Acid (HA) is far from a simple moisturizer; it’s a glycosaminoglycan, a type of sugar molecule naturally present in our skin that can hold up to 1,000 times its weight in water. The key innovation in advanced serums like Regenovue plus is the use of HA in multiple molecular weights. A single-weight HA can only penetrate so far. A multi-weight system, however, creates a tiered hydration network on and within the skin.

  • High-Molecular-Weight HA remains on the skin’s surface, forming a breathable, hydrating film that instantly plumps the skin and reduces the appearance of fine lines caused by dehydration.
  • Low-Molecular-Weight HA penetrates deeper into the epidermis, delivering sustained hydration to the living skin cells and providing a reservoir of moisture that lasts for hours.

Clinical studies have demonstrated that formulations containing multi-weight hyaluronic acid can increase skin hydration by over 40% within the first hour of application and maintain significantly improved hydration levels for 24 hours. This intense hydration is the foundational step for all other anti-aging benefits, as well-hydrated skin is more receptive to active ingredients and has a stronger, healthier barrier function.

The Cellular Messengers: Signal Peptides

Peptides are short chains of amino acids, the building blocks of proteins like collagen and elastin. As we age, the natural production of these structural proteins declines. The specific peptides in this formulation, Palmitoyl Tripeptide-1 and Palmitoyl Tetrapeptide-7, are known as “signal peptides.” Their primary function is not to become collagen themselves, but to act as messengers, sending signals to the skin’s fibroblasts (the cells responsible for producing collagen) to “wake up” and ramp up production.

Think of it as a gentle, continuous nudge to your skin’s natural repair mechanisms. This process is crucial because it addresses aging at its root cause—the loss of structural support. By stimulating the skin’s own collagen synthesis, peptides help to:

  • Improve skin firmness and elasticity.
  • Reduce the depth and appearance of wrinkles.
  • Enhance skin density and thickness, which naturally diminishes with age.

Research on these specific peptides shows that after 12 weeks of use, participants observed a measurable reduction in wrinkle volume and a significant improvement in skin firmness, with results visible in as little as 4 weeks.

The Protector and Brightener: Tetrahexydecyl Ascorbate (Vitamin C) & Niacinamide

This duo represents the defensive and corrective arm of the formula. Not all Vitamin C derivatives are created equal. Tetrahexydecyl Ascorbate is a lipid-soluble, highly stable form of Vitamin C. This means it can penetrate the lipid-rich cell membranes much more effectively than water-soluble forms like L-Ascorbic Acid, which is notoriously unstable and can oxidize quickly. Its primary benefits are:

  • Antioxidant Protection: It neutralizes free radicals generated by UV exposure and pollution before they can damage collagen and cause premature aging.
  • Collagen Synthesis: It is a essential cofactor for the enzymes that produce collagen, meaning it directly supports the creation of new, healthy collagen fibers.
  • Brightening: It inhibits the enzyme tyrosinase, which is involved in melanin production, helping to fade hyperpigmentation and even out skin tone.

Niacinamide, or Vitamin B3, is a true multi-tasker that complements Vitamin C perfectly. While Vitamin C is a potent antioxidant, Niacinamide works on multiple fronts to strengthen the skin barrier and reduce inflammation. Its key actions include:

  • Barrier Repair: It boosts the production of ceramides and fatty acids, essential components of the skin’s protective barrier. A stronger barrier means better moisture retention and less sensitivity.
  • Anti-Inflammatory: It helps calm redness and can be beneficial for conditions like acne and rosacea.
  • Pore Refining & Sebum Regulation: It can help minimize the appearance of enlarged pores by reducing excess oil production.

The combination of a stable Vitamin C and Niacinamide creates a powerful environment for skin repair and protection, defending against future damage while correcting existing concerns like dullness and uneven texture.
